Sun Nov 10 00:40:00 UTC 2024: ## Virginia Cavaliers Face Tough Test Against Ranked Pitt Panthers
**Pittsburgh, PA** – The Virginia Cavaliers are set to face a tough challenge on Saturday night as they travel to Acrisure Stadium to take on the No. 23 ranked Pittsburgh Panthers. The game, scheduled for 8:00 PM ET on the ACC Network, will be a crucial one for both teams as they navigate the latter half of their respective seasons.
The Panthers are coming off a disappointing loss to SMU, which dealt a blow to their ACC Championship hopes. A victory against Virginia is essential for Pitt to stay in contention for the title and maintain a chance at a College Football Playoff berth.
The Cavaliers, meanwhile, are in a slump, having lost their last three games. They face a daunting schedule ahead and a win over Pitt is crucial to becoming bowl eligible.
The game features intriguing matchups. Virginia’s linebackers will face a tough task in containing Desmond Reid, Pitt’s all-purpose threat, who averages over 150 all-purpose yards per game. On the other side, Virginia wide receiver Malachi Fields could exploit the Panthers’ aggressive blitzing style.
Pitt linebacker Kyle Louis will be a key player for the Panthers as they look to bounce back from their loss. He leads the team in sacks and tackles for loss and is known for making game-changing plays.
The Panthers have dominated the series since joining the ACC in 2013, winning seven of nine meetings. However, Virginia has managed to lead at some point in each of their last three games, despite losing.
